Patroli Rutin Malam, Polsek Bugul Kidul Sempatkan Pantau Situasi Perlintasan Rel Kereta Api.

Published

on

Polresta Pasuruan – Polsek Bugul Kidul -Personil Polsek Bugul Kidul Polres Pasuruan Kota melaksanakan patroli rutin malam hari yang dilaksanakan oleh KA SPK Aiptu Soleman bersama Aipda Fian Pandu Andika dengan Sasaran Area Perlintasan Rel kereta Api di Kelurahan Blandongan Kecamatan Bugul Kidul Kota Pasuruan, Sabtu (28/01/2023) jam 23.45 Wib.

Guna memberi rasa aman terhadap warga dalam melakukan aktifitas pada wilayah hukum Polsek Bugul Kidul, selain itu personil juga beri himbauan Kamtibmas kepada para penjaga jalur lintasan kereta api untuk tetap utamakan keselamatan pengguna jalan.

Di samping itu di harapkan kepada penjaga jalur lintasan kereta api untuk menjadi mitra Polri dengan cara melaporkan kepada Polsek Bugul Kidul apabila menemukan atau mengetahui adanya gangguan Kamtibmas di sekitar lingkungannya, guna mempercepat personil merespon adanya aduan warga,”Ucap Aiptu Soleman”.

Adapun maksud dan tujuan giat di laksanakan yaitu mencegah adanya gangguan kamtibmas, serta lakukan sosialisasi tentang layanan pengaduan warga melalui media sosial, baik itu via Whatsapp, Instagram maupun Tik Tok, sehingga pengaduan warga dengan cepat direspon oleh operator Polres Pasuruan Kota khususnya Polsek Bugul Kidul guna tercipta situasi yang aman sejuk dan kondusif,”Pungkasnya”.

Coronavirus disease 2019

Published

on

COVID-19 is a contagious disease caused by the coronavirus SARS-CoV-2. In January 2020, the disease spread worldwide, resulting in the COVID-19 pandemic.

The symptoms of COVID‑19 can vary but often include fever,[7] fatigue, cough, breathing difficulties, loss of smell, and loss of taste.[8][9][10] Symptoms may begin one to fourteen days after exposure to the virus. At least a third of people who are infected do not develop noticeable symptoms.[11][12] Of those who develop symptoms noticeable enough to be classified as patients, most (81%) develop mild to moderate symptoms (up to mild pneumonia), while 14% develop severe symptoms (dyspnea, hypoxia, or more than 50% lung involvement on imaging), and 5% develop critical symptoms (respiratory failure, shock, or multiorgan dysfunction).[13] Older people have a higher risk of developing severe symptoms. Some complications result in death. Some people continue to experience a range of effects (long COVID) for months or years after infection, and damage to organs has been observed.[14] Multi-year studies on the long-term effects are ongoing.[15]

COVID‑19 transmission occurs when infectious particles are breathed in or come into contact with the eyes, nose, or mouth. The risk is highest when people are in close proximity, but small airborne particles containing the virus can remain suspended in the air and travel over longer distances, particularly indoors. Transmission can also occur when people touch their eyes, nose, or mouth after touching surfaces or objects that have been contaminated by the virus. People remain contagious for up to 20 days and can spread the virus even if they do not develop symptoms.[16]

Testing methods for COVID-19 to detect the virus’s nucleic acid include real-time reverse transcription polymerase chain reaction (RT‑PCR),[17][18] transcription-mediated amplification,[17][18][19] and reverse transcription loop-mediated isothermal amplification (RT‑LAMP)[17][18] from a nasopharyngeal swab.[20]

Several COVID-19 vaccines have been approved and distributed in various countries, many of which have initiated mass vaccination campaigns. Other preventive measures include physical or social distancing, quarantining, ventilation of indoor spaces, use of face masks or coverings in public, covering coughs and sneezes, hand washing, and keeping unwashed hands away from the face. While drugs have been developed to inhibit the virus, the primary treatment is still symptomatic, managing the disease through supportive care, isolation, and experimental measures.
